BBQ Beef and Apple Meatballs

BBQ Beef and Apple Meatballs

with Creamy Mashed Potatoes and Side Salad

Grab some extra napkins because things are about to get saucy! These succulent beef meatballs are smothered in sweet and savoury BBQ sauce. Served with creamy mashed potatoes, crispy shallots and a fresh salad, this meal has got it all.

Instructions

Prep
1
  • Peel, then cut potatoes into 1-inch pieces.
  • Core apple. Coarsely grate half the apple. Thinly slice remaining apple.
  • Halve tomatoes.
Cook potatoes
2
  • Add potatoes, 2 tsp salt and enough water to cover (approx. 1 inch) to a large pot (use same for 4 ppl). Cover and bring to a boil over high heat.
  • Once boiling, reduce heat to medium-high. Simmer uncovered until fork-tender, 10-12 min.
Form and roast meatballs
3
  • Add beef, breadcrumbs, grated apple, BBQ Seasoning and 1/4 tsp (1/2 tsp) salt to a large bowl. Season with pepper, then combine.
  • Roll mixture into 12 equal-sized meatballs (24 meatballs for 4 ppl).
  • Arrange on a foil-lined baking sheet.
  • Roast in the middle of the oven until golden-brown and cooked through, 12-14 min.**
Mash potatoes
4
  • When potatoes are fork-tender, drain and return to the same pot, off heat.
  • Mash cream, cream cheese and 1 tbsp (2 tbsp) butter into potatoes until creamy. 
  • Season with salt and pepper, to taste, then stir to combine.


Make salad
5
  • Whisk together vinegar, 1/2 tsp (1 tsp) sugar and 1 tbsp (2 tbsp) oil in a medium bowl.
  • Add tomatoes, apple slices and spinach.
  • Season with salt and pepper, then toss to combine.


Finish and serve
6
  • When meatballs are done, melt 1 tbsp (2 tbsp) butter in a small microwavable bowl, 30 sec.
  • Add meatballs, BBQ sauce, melted butter and 1/2 tbsp (1 tbsp) water to another large bowl, then toss to coat.
  • Divide mashed potatoes between plates, then top with meatballs and any remaining sauce from the large bowl.
  • Sprinkle crispy shallots over top.
  • Serve salad alongside.
